SHAPES EVENT 10TH MARCH 2011

The Friends of The Black Watch Castle and Museum hosted the Shapes event at Balhousie Castle and Museum on Thursday 10th March.

We had a fabulous day when a team from Shapes Fine Art Auctioneers and Valuers visited the Castle to host an Antique Valuation Day. Emma Scott, Regional Development Officer arrived with valuers Hamish Wilson, Dr Thomson and Richard Longwill. The team arrived and set up their stations just in time for the early morning rush. We had visitors from near and far pay us a visit. There was a host of antiques that came through our doors – jewellery, watches, paintings, plates, dolls, vases and many more. Some visitors brought in items just to find out what it was! We had many a smiling face leave the Castle. The day was a great success. All money raised on the day will go to the Friends organisation. This money will be used to support the work of the museum and its staff to preserve the legacy of the Black Watch and it's Regimental home at Balhousie Castle.
